WebSep 6, 2024 · Yes! Buckwheat is Paleo friendly ! Buckwheat is a Pseudocereal, not a true cereal grain like wheat or barley. A pseudocereal is a seed that is used in the same way as grains. Buckwheat is high in protein and fiber and is a good source of minerals such as magnesium, potassium, and zinc. It is also gluten-free, making it a great option for those ... WebSep 16, 2016 · Buckwheat groats are decidedly starchier than, say, flax (another story altogether) or pumpkin seeds, so we must use caution. Buckwheat’s glycemic index is 54, which is still fairly high despite being lower than actual grains. Historically speaking, buckwheat certainly isn’t paleo. Grains, dairy, potatoes, beans, lentils, … robert ellerbusch obituary californiaWebOct 20, 2024 · A paleo diet is an eating plan based on foods humans might have eaten during the Paleolithic Era. The Paleolithic Era dates from around 2.5 million to 10,000 years ago. A modern paleo diet includes fruits, vegetables, lean meats, fish, eggs, nuts and seeds.
